„Organik“ DAC Upgrade for Linn Klimax Streamers

All "Klimax" streamers from Linn can now be retrofitted with "Organik", the first DAC developed in-house by the Scottish manufacturer.

The D/A converter "Organik", completely developed by Linn themselves, was introduced last year as part of the newest generation of the flagship streamer "Klimax DSM". Linn has now announced that all of their old "Klimax DS" and "Klimax DSM" streamers – all the way back to the first devices from 2007 – can get an "Organik" upgrade; the same applies to the "Klimax Exaktbox" as well as the "Klimax 350" integrated speakers.

The Organik digital-to-analog converter is discrete and is said to offer extremely low levels of noise as well as distortion. In addition to the special "Delta-Sigma" pulse width modulation (PWM) and "Discrete Analog Finite Impulse Response (AFIR)" during conversion, this is said to be ensured by a precise clock generator, a discrete power supply, and an optimized circuit board design. Organik can work with music data up to DSD256 and 24-bit/384kHz.

All old Klimax DS and Klimax DSM models from Linn can now be retrofitted with the new Organik D/A converter – at a price of €5,400 (excl. taxes). New Klimax Exaktboxes and Klimax 350 active speakers carry the DAC as standard, just like the new Klimax DSM. Old Klimax 350s can be retrofitted with the Organik at a price of €10,800 (excl. taxes), the Klimax Exaktbox for €5,400 (excl. taxes).
